WebEarly hot air engines. Robert Stirling is considered one of the fathers of hot air engines, notwithstanding some earlier predecessors—notably Guillaume Amontons, who succeeded in building, in 1699, the first working hot air engine.. Amontons was later followed by Sir George Cayley. I've been returning to the game and kinda lazy to farm the gold again, so I wanna use cheat engine to get back to as close to my old save as fast as possible but in this game cheat engine don't work with normal value, I forgot the formula … how many words can you write in 50 minutesWebAs its name suggests, the steam engine operates on the force of water vapor (steam) heated to high pressure. It is a technology that converts thermal energy (heat) to mechanical energy (work). The boiler heats the water turning it to steam.
